  1. Click ‘Get Form’ to open the andrew macrina scholarship fund application in the editor.
  2. Begin with Section 1: Personal Information. Fill in your date, last name, first name, home address, city, state, zip code, home phone, cell phone, and email address.
  3. Proceed to Section 2: Current Education. Enter the educational institution's name and address, date of enrollment, current GPAs for non-culinary and culinary courses, degree pursued, and anticipated graduation date.
  4. In Section 3: Additional Education, list any other educational institutions attended along with their details.
  5. Complete Section 4: Current Employment by providing your employer's name, address, job title, supervisor's contact information, and employment dates.
  6. Fill out Section 5: Past Industry Experience with similar details for previous employers over the last five years.
  7. Ensure all required essays are completed in the designated section on page 5. Each response should be a minimum of 50 words.
  8. Finally, review your application for accuracy before submitting it through our platform for free.

Can You Get a Scholarship with a 3.0 GPA? Yes, there are many scholarships available for students with a 3.0 GPA. Most academic merit-based scholarships require minimum GPAs of between 2.0 and 3.0, with more competitive awards sometimes requiring a GPA of 3.5 or higher.

Can I Get a Full-Ride Scholarship With a 3.5 GPA? Securing a full-ride scholarship with a 3.5 GPA is challenging but not impossible. Generally, full-ride scholarships and general tuition scholarships tend to favor students with exceptional academic records, typically above a 3.5 GPA.
Students who hold a GPA between 3.5 to 4.0 may distinguish themselves to institutions awarding academic scholarships. Since many students may receive high GPAs, colleges often grant scholarships to those who meet other criteria in addition to having a high GPA.

The National Merit Scholarship Program stands as a pinnacle of academic achievement for high school students across the United States. Established to recognize and reward exceptional academic performance, this program identifies top scorers in the Preliminary SAT/National Merit Scholarship Qualifying Test (PSAT/NMSQT).
